How to Gain Self Confidence as an Adult

This Personal Development Article is Brought To You By - Susan Nickerson DC

Most of us, regardless of what we portray to others, suffer from an unhealthy lack of self confidence in our lives. Often, we try to give off the false appearance of having strong self confidence to hide this fact from our colleagues, peers, and family members. We are driven by the fear that others will discover the truth and treat us with less respect.

If you are like most people, you understand exactly what this feels like and how it cripples you in your daily life. Fortunately, you can easily correct this and discover how to gain self confidence as an adult. This will have everyone around you in awe and admiration of your sense of personal strength.

You will be amazed at how easy it is to become a stronger and more confident person by simply implementing the following changes in your daily life:

Be More Decisive

The actual nature of your decision isn’t as important as the fact that you make it and stick to it. As you start acting decisively on a regular basis, you will realize that the decisions you are making are generally correct — and lead to greater success in accomplishing your goals. Making firm decisions is therefore certain to boost your self-esteem and gain admiration from others.

Eliminate Fear and Anxiety from Your Daily Life

Fear is the primary emotion preventing you from accomplishing your goals. If you think you are forever trapped in your current situation, you most likely will be. To rid yourself of your fear:

First, clearly identify in your mind the cause of your fear or anxiety. Second, surprise your fear by doing exactly what you don’t usually do. In order to accomplish this step, it is important that you don’t prejudge the outcome of your act (that is, assume you have no idea what will result from your act).

Typically, your fear of “punishment” or “failure” or “rejection” prevents you from doing what you are afraid of trying. But if you don’t have any expectations of how your actions will turn out, you can’t fear failure.

Become a Person of Action

Action of itself clears uncertainty. Therefore, you must act without concern for possible error.

Most people don’t worry about a mistake itself – we realize that errors are often helpful lessons. What bothers us is the possibility that we might appear foolish to ourselves or others. The courageous person is someone who is willing to expose himself to big mistakes.
It is more important to focus on the means of accomplishing your actions than the results that stem from them. You need to adopt a stance of indifference to the results of your actions. Over time, you will come to see that you inevitably will experience more success than failure.
When you are indifferent to something, you generally have no fear of it. This lack of fear is in a sense a type of courage, and this courage will lead to improved performance, more success, and a growing self confidence.

Change the Nature of Your Interactions with People

Honestly examine and face the kind of person you are, develop an acceptance of that person, and then present only your true self to others. Don’t try and be someone who you are not. Others will always see right through this.

Don’t try too hard to please people. Instead, be emotionally honest and act the way you naturally feel. Being your true self is always much more attractive to others than acting in a way you think others will find attractive.

The following five steps will help you develop the kind of personality that attracts others:

Step 1: Make a list of 12-15 people that you want to attract.
Step 2: Do nothing to attract them. Do the opposite of what you would normally do – go about your life without them.
Step 3: If you hear from these people, be friendly and independent – tell them you’ve been busy living.
Step 4: You now have an even give-and-take relationship with these people. Keep it that way.
Step 5: Cross those people that don’t call you off the list. Your relationship with them is not mutual, and your goal is to eliminate all one-sided relationships in your life.

Now you’ve discovered how to gain self confidence as an adult. By following these steps, you will soon discover that many people in your life find you far more attractive than you ever thought they did. This discovery will certainly boost your self confidence.
